FOUNDATIONAL TERM
tissue
组织
An organized arrangement of cells and associated material that contributes to particular functions.

02 · From Cells to the Human Body
The body is made of cells, but naming its cells cannot by itself explain how a heart pumps or skin provides protection. Arrangement, connections, and the material surrounding cells also determine what an organ can do.
